Explore the intersection of machine learning and quantum applications in this 39-minute lecture delivered by Eliska Greplova from Delft University of Technology. Gain insights into the fundamental concepts and potential applications of machine learning techniques in quantum systems. Discover how these cutting-edge technologies are shaping the future of quantum research and development.
